Gem 查找SASS可执行文件的位置。(使用rbenv)

Gem 查找SASS可执行文件的位置。(使用rbenv),gem,sass,webstorm,rbenv,Gem,Sass,Webstorm,Rbenv,我有一个工作SASS安装。我可以在终端中运行这些命令并获得以下输出: sass -v Sass 3.2.9 (Media Mark) rbenv versions system * 1.9.3-p392 (set by /Users/Eric/.rbenv/version) 2.0.0-p0 我需要找到可执行文件,以便作为文件监视程序提供给Webstorm IDE。我以前在其他环境(windows、没有rbenv的osx)中也设置过,但我不知道如何在这里设置 如果我运行where i

我有一个工作SASS安装。我可以在终端中运行这些命令并获得以下输出:

sass -v
Sass 3.2.9 (Media Mark)

rbenv versions
  system
* 1.9.3-p392 (set by /Users/Eric/.rbenv/version)
  2.0.0-p0
我需要找到可执行文件,以便作为文件监视程序提供给Webstorm IDE。我以前在其他环境(windows、没有rbenv的osx)中也设置过,但我不知道如何在这里设置

如果我运行
where is sass
,则不会得到任何输出

如何找到此可执行文件并为Webstorm指定它

深入rbenv,我在这里看到:
/Users/Eric/.rbenv/versions/1.9.3-p392/lib/ruby/gems/1.9.1/gems/sass-3.2.9/bin/sass

指定webstorm的此路径确实有效。直接引用此位置是否合适/稳定,或者是否有更好的方法不依赖于版本号?

这对我来说是一个可行的答案:

/Users/Eric/.rbenv/versions/1.9.3-p392/lib/ruby/gems/1.9.1/gems/sass-3.2.9/bin/sass
这不是最好的,因为我升级SASS时必须更新位置,但它很实用。希望这对其他人有帮助


如果有人知道rbenv或ruby通过升级维护的可执行文件的符号链接,请分享。

这是一个对我有用的答案:

/Users/Eric/.rbenv/versions/1.9.3-p392/lib/ruby/gems/1.9.1/gems/sass-3.2.9/bin/sass
这不是最好的,因为我升级SASS时必须更新位置,但它很实用。希望这对其他人有帮助


如果有人知道通过rbenv或ruby升级维护的可执行文件的符号链接,请共享。

使用
哪个sass
,而不是
在哪里
。它应该位于您的
~/.rbenv/bin
位置。

使用
哪个sass
而不是
在哪里
。它应该位于您的
~/.rbenv/bin
位置。

??